Pipeline ADC mallintaminen Simulink

S

suhas_shiv

Guest
Hei kaikki, olen käynyt läpi joitakin papereita Putkistohankkeita ADC mallinnus Simulink. Jotkut paperit ovat käyttäneet Matlab Funktion laatikko (omilla koodi luulisin) osa-ADC ja sub-DAC. Halusin tietää, millainen toiminta voisi kuvata sellaisia lohkoja? Onko ADC / DAC korttelin helposti saatavilla Simulink tai olisin kirjoittaa toiminto / code edustamaan heitä? Jos minun täytyy kirjoittaa koodia, voisi joku antaa minulle vihjeen / idea siitä, miten edetä. Mitään vastausta on tervetullutta. Thanks. Suhas
 
Se on aika inhottava, koska et luultavasti halua malli vertailuryhmässä aikaero jotkut Gaussin käyrään ja vertailut on tehtävä käsin. Tämä tarkoittaa, sinun täytyy rakentaa vertailuryhmässä rutiini, joka tekee tietyt lähtö perustuu joihinkin johdotus päästökauppajärjestelmään vertailuryhmässä koodeja. Ehdotan ulostulo DAC ihanteellinen, koska mallinnus epäsuhta on reaaalllyyy aikaa vievää. Viimeinen ehdotus: yrittää kirjoittaa rutiini MEX, se säästää valtava määrä sim aikaa.
 
Ensin malli tietokoneellesi Pääluokista sub korttelin ... se contain...comparators....S / H...m-DAC...dig korjaus korttelin jne. ... nyt vain kirjoittaa rutiinit jokaisesta niistä .... tämä rutiini pohjimmiltaan sisältää IP-OP-suhde lohkojen (jännite-verkkotunnuksen ).... aivan kuten C-ohj .... Kun tämä on tehty te kutsutte niitä asianmukaisesti .... kai tämä tekee työtä .... Olen kerran tehnyt sen MATLAB ... ei simulaink .... näin yksinkertaisia matemaattisia tehtäviä se tehtiin .... Nyt voit antaa joitakin muuttuja offset / virhe viittauksessa / S / H tai M-DAC .... vain laittaa ne mathimatecally ..... tulette saamaan sitä .... Voin antaa sinulle yhden viittauksen ...... vaikka tämä ei liity mallintamisen Simulink ... mutta käsittelee noin kaasuputken ADC hyvässä tavalla .... voi auttaa .... Digitaalinen tekniikka parantaa tietojen tarkkuus muuntimet Un-Ku Moon; Temes, GC, Steensgaard, J.; Communications Magazine, IEEE Volume 37, Issue 10, lokakuu 1999 Page (s): 136-143 Digital Object Identifier 10.1109/35.795604 Yhteenveto: Tässä artikkelissa Tutorial yleiskatsaus joistakin aiemmin kehittänyt menetelmiä parantaa tarkkuutta ja lineaarisuus data muuntimet (analoginen-digitaali sekä digitaali-analogia) ottamalla käyttöön ylimääräisiä digitaalinen piiri, joka kalibroi, c. ... . gd onnea ... sankudey
 
[Quote = ICX] Mitä MEX? [/Quote] Luulen, MEX on lyhyt Matlab laajennus ja sen avulla voit laittaa C-koodi Matlab-koodin kautta kirjaston käyttöliittymän. Se pelasti minut tunnin aikana oman putkiston sim ohjelmointia. Tämä on mitä Help sanoo: Esittelyssä MEX-Files Voit soittaa oman C tai Fortran aliohjelmia MATLAB kuin ne olisivat valmiita funktioita. MATLAB omavelkaisia C ja Fortran-ohjelmia kutsutaan MEX-tiedostoja. MEX-tiedostot dynaamisesti linkitetty aliohjelmia että MATLAB tulkki voi automaattisesti ladata ja suorittaa. MEX-tiedostoja on useita sovelluksia: Suuret ennestään C-ja Fortran-ohjelmia voidaan kutsua MATLAB ilman kirjoittaa uudelleen M-tiedostoja. Pullonkaula laskentaan (yleensä-kaarta), jotka eivät juokse tarpeeksi nopeasti MATLAB voidaan recoded C tai Fortran tehokkuutta. MEX-tiedostot eivät sovi kaikkiin sovelluksiin. MATLAB on korkean tuottavuuden järjestelmä, jonka erikoisuus on poistaa aikaa vievää, matalalla ohjelmointi koottu kielet kuten Fortran tai C. Yleensä useimmat ohjelmointi pitäisi tehdä MATLAB. Älä käytä MEX laitos ellei sovellus sitä edellyttää.
 
Rooli osa-DAC on toimittaa vahvistuksen vaiheessa analoginen jännite taso, joka edustaa kvantittunut osa tulosignaalin näyte. Koska on piiri Alma-Bukic täytäntöönpanovaltaa sub_DAC. Toisaalta .... sub-ADC on osa niin soita johonkin bittinen ADC tai yleensä kutsutaan vertailuryhmässä .
 

Welcome to EDABoard.com

Sponsor

Back
Top